The votes are in, and Cardinal Newman’s Lauren Rivers wins the vote for The State’s Midlands High School Volleyball Player of the Week.

This week’s nominees

Ceigan Carter, Keenan: Senior outside hitter had 14 kills, 21 digs, six aces in two matches last week.

Gabby Esposito, Gilbert: Sophomore had 36 kills, 28 digs and three aces in two matches last week.

Grayson Graham, Spring Valley: Senior had 11 aces, 17 kills, 32 digs and 51 service receptions in two matches last week.

Mia Hammond, Columbia: Senior had 12 aces during the match against American Leadership.

Camryn Jeffery, Westwood: Senior middle hitter had 67 kills, 39 service receptions, 38 digs and 12 blocks in two matches last week.

Lauren Rivers, Cardinal Newman: Freshman setter had 103 assists, 46 digs and seven aces in three matches.

Caroline Tucker, River Bluff: Junior outside hitter had 50 kills, 44 digs and 42 service receptions in eight matches at Dorman Tournament of Champions.
